Transaction e96236cc97dedd99b0acf14253f306d2304cff67d2f74603af3c08f17e91c81e
1 Input
1 Outputs
- e96236cc97dedd99b0acf14253f306d2304cff67d2f74603af3c08f17e91c81e:0
value 987023
address 3D2o6L6yE5TEBbFcUZ5g3aXv28wxtabgap